SINGAPORE - Babies born next year will receive eight presents as part of the Jubilee gift set which celebrates Singapore's 50th birthday.

These are: a special medallion; a multi-functional shawl; a baby sling; a set of baby clothes including a T-shirt and bottoms, rompers, mittens and socks; a diaper bag; a scrapbook for memories; a family photo frame; and a baby book.

These came out top during a month-long poll that ended in May, during which people picked the ideas they most wanted to be included in the gift set.

The gifts are "a balance of practical and meaningful items", said the National Population and Talent Division in a statement on Friday.

"The Jubilee Baby Gift symbolises our best wishes, hopes and aspirations from this generation of Singaporeans to the next. We hope that parents will enjoy the gift as they use the items to care for their babies, to capture happy memories for their families, and to commemorate their child's birth in the Jubilee Year," said Ms Anita Fam, who chairs the Jubilee Baby Gift advisory panel.

More details on how parents will receive the Jubilee Baby Gift will be announced later this year.
